(KANEOHE BAY, Hawaii) Naval Facilities Engineering Command (NAVFAC) Pacific public-private venture (PPV) partner, Hawaii Military Communities, LLC (a Forest City Enterprises subsidiary), hosted a ceremonial demolition April 15 as it reached a key milestone. Marine Col. Brian Annichiarico, Marine Corps Base Hawaii base commander, operated an excavator to tear down the last old home in the Ulupau neighborhood during the ceremony. This event signified the last of 1,520 homes to be demolished and replaced in this PPV project that started October 2007 and is expected to be completed by April 2014. The Ulupau replacement project was included as Phase 5 of the PPV and was awarded by NAVFAC Pacific Oct. 1, 2010. U.S. Navy photo by Christine Rosalin |
